Is it better to tip cash or card?

From the viewpoint of the server or person being tipped, cash is generally preferred. That is not just because a less scrupulous server may skip reporting some cash tips as income and evade taxes. Merchants have to pay a small fee to the credit card company for each payment that is processed.

Should you write cash on tip line?

Although you may add a tip to the credit card transaction receipt, tipped workers usually prefer cash because they get the money right away and don’t have to worry about bookkeeping mistakes on their employer’s part. However, the method of paying a tip is entirely up to you.

What percentage of people pay with cash at restaurant?

“In 2015, cash remained the most frequently used retail payment instrument, used in nearly one-third (32 percent) of all transactions, including bill payments,” the Fed found. “Consumers used debit cards for 27 percent of their transactions, followed by credit cards for 21 percent of transactions.”

Why are bars cash only?

There are several reasons: 1. Transaction fees: Restaurants and bars look to cut costs in any way they can. The 1 to 3 percent fees that banks charge on non-cash transactions can add up to a significant number at the end of each month.

Why do restaurants want you to pay in cash?

Restaurants that advocate the use of cash point out the high cost of mobile wallet and credit-card processing (from just under 2 percent to 4 percent). Processing fees are levied on check totals (sales, sales tax, and tip), which is why both tipped employees and the house prefer that guests tip in cash.
